The following are common examples of Airflow REST API requests that you can run against a Deployment on Astro. You interact with the API by using the endpoint that will help you to accomplish the task that you need to accomplish. Most of these endpoints accept input in a JSON format and return the output in a JSON format. Replace with your Deployment URL from Step 1. The Airflow REST API facilitates management by providing a number of REST API endpoints across its objects.I have already discussed quite a few in my previous blogs. SimpleHttpOperator, can get data from RESTful web services, process it, and write it to databases using other operators, but do not return it in the response to the HTTP POST that runs the workflow DAG. Use the Astro access token from Step 1 for authentication. There are various ways to make API calls from your Airflow Dag. Airflow seems to be used primarily to create data pipelines for ETL (extract, transform, load) workflows, the existing Airflow Operators, e.g.The data pipeline chosen here is a simple pattern with three separate. You can use a third party client, such as curl, HTTPie,nPostman or the Insomnia rest client to testnthe Apache Airflow. n Any changes to the API will first go through a deprecation phase. n APIs are designed to be backward compatible. To make a request based on Airflow documentation, make sure to: This tutorial builds on the regular Airflow Tutorial and focuses specifically on writing data pipelines using the TaskFlow API paradigm which is introduced as part of Airflow 2.0 and contrasts this with DAGs written using the traditional paradigm. API versioning is not synchronized to specific releases of the Apache Airflow. You can execute requests against any endpoint that is listed in the Airflow REST API reference. For example, if the home page of your Deployment Airflow UI is hosted at /dz3uu847/home, your Deployment URL is /dz3uu847. If the time limit is exceeded, the person in charge is notified and the. Find the reference documentation, examples and best practices here. Airflow allows you to define how quickly a task or entire workflow must be completed. This is the Deployment URL you will use to access the Airflow API.įor example, if the Astro CLI returns /dz3uu847?orgId=org_clq52a121000008i8d, your Deployment URL is /dz3uu847.Īlternatively, you can retrieve your Deployment URL by opening the Airflow UI for your Deployment on Astro and copying the URL of the page up to /home. Learn how to use the stable REST API of Airflow, a platform for programmatically authoring, scheduling and monitoring workflows. What differentiates an endpoint system from others? What if you have a SIEM system with an agent, is this now.Copy everything up to but not including the ? in the output generated by the command. There are a lot of them, and you can find them rated in multiple places. I'd like to get a discussion going about Endpoint detection and systems. What does Endpoint protection mean to you and what do you use? Security.We are working towards removing local admin off all our workstations but we have run into an issue where we cannot use msra to remote into machines because it will prompt them for an admin password to allow us access. Send logs to s3 - Official Airflow Helm Chart + KubernetesExecutor. Accessing the REST API from airflow running in Kubernetes. How to call a REST end point using Airflow DAG. Note: Access control to Airflow Database API & Airflow Database rows is out of scope for this AIP, but it was kept in mind, making the implementation feasible. It allows isolating some components (Worker, DagProcessor and Triggerer) from direct access to DB. Hello Spiceheads.How are you implementing MFA/TFA on VPN? Or are you.Is this something that you can do via the firewall, or are you using a third party service?OpenVPN or Wireguard extraEnv: - name: AIRFLOWAPIAUTHBACKENDS value: .basicauth Share. Airflow Database APi is a new independent component of Airflow. I manage (and help manage) multiple domains in single-domain forests.Our Security team from Domain A in Forest A wants to be able to read the GPOs in Domain B in Forest B.They can see everything but the Computer and User Configuration information-the jui.
0 Comments
Leave a Reply. |
AuthorWrite something about yourself. No need to be fancy, just an overview. ArchivesCategories |